The Operational Complexity of Modern Education Institutions
Education institutions operate in a uniquely complex environment where academic, administrative, and financial processes are deeply interdependent. Unlike traditional manufacturing or retail sectors, the core product of an educational institution is knowledge transfer, which requires precise coordination of faculty, students, facilities, and resources. This complexity creates significant challenges for operational reporting and workflow alignment. Disconnected systems often lead to data silos, where academic records, financial transactions, and resource allocations exist in separate databases with no unified view. This fragmentation makes it difficult for executives to gain real-time visibility into institutional performance, leading to delayed decision-making and potential compliance risks. The primary operational problem is not a lack of data, but a lack of structured, aligned data flows that support consistent reporting and efficient workflow execution.
In many institutions, the Student Information System (SIS) serves as the system of record for academic data, while financial systems handle billing and accounting. However, these systems often lack robust integration, requiring manual data entry or periodic batch transfers. This manual intervention introduces errors, delays, and inconsistencies. For example, a change in a student's enrollment status in the SIS may not immediately reflect in the billing system, leading to incorrect tuition invoices or missed financial aid applications. Similarly, faculty workload data may not align with budget allocations, causing resource mismanagement. The result is a fragmented operational landscape where departments operate in isolation, and central leadership struggles to enforce standardized processes. Addressing this requires a strategic approach to ERP planning that prioritizes workflow alignment and data integrity.
Defining the Scope of Education ERP Planning
Effective ERP planning for education begins with a comprehensive understanding of the institution's operational landscape. This involves mapping out all key business processes, from student admission and enrollment to faculty hiring, course scheduling, tuition billing, and financial reporting. The goal is to identify where current workflows are inefficient, error-prone, or disconnected. This discovery phase is critical for defining the scope of the ERP implementation. It is not about replacing every existing system but about identifying the core processes that require unified management and reporting. For most institutions, this includes financial management, human resources, procurement, and academic administration.
The scope should also consider the institution's size, structure, and regulatory environment. A multi-campus university, for example, will have different reporting and workflow requirements than a single-campus community college. Multi-campus institutions need robust data aggregation and standardized processes across locations, while smaller institutions may prioritize simplicity and ease of use. Additionally, the regulatory environment, including financial aid compliance, accreditation requirements, and data privacy laws, must be factored into the planning process. The ERP system must be capable of supporting these regulatory requirements through built-in controls, audit trails, and reporting capabilities. This ensures that the institution remains compliant while improving operational efficiency.
Aligning Odoo Applications with Academic Workflows
Odoo offers a modular approach to ERP, allowing institutions to select and configure applications that align with their specific operational needs. For education institutions, key Odoo applications include Accounting, Invoicing, Human Resources, Project, and Inventory. The Accounting module serves as the central hub for financial data, ensuring that all transactions, from tuition payments to vendor invoices, are recorded in a unified ledger. The Invoicing module can be configured to handle complex billing scenarios, including tuition, fees, and financial aid, with automated reconciliation and payment tracking. This reduces manual effort and minimizes errors in financial reporting.
The Human Resources module supports faculty and staff management, including recruitment, onboarding, performance evaluation, and payroll. This is critical for aligning faculty workload with budget allocations and ensuring that staffing levels meet academic demands. The Project module can be used to manage academic programs, research projects, and administrative initiatives, providing visibility into resource allocation and project progress. The Inventory module, while less obvious, can be used to manage educational resources, such as textbooks, laboratory equipment, and facilities, ensuring that resources are allocated efficiently and tracked accurately. By aligning these Odoo applications with academic workflows, institutions can create a unified operational platform that supports consistent reporting and efficient process execution.
Data Integration and System of Record Responsibilities
Data integration is a critical component of education ERP planning. The ERP system must integrate with existing systems, such as the Student Information System (SIS), Learning Management System (LMS), and payment gateways, to ensure data consistency and accuracy. This integration can be achieved through APIs, middleware, or direct database connections, depending on the institution's technical infrastructure. The key is to define clear system of record responsibilities for each data type. For example, the SIS should remain the system of record for academic data, while the ERP system should be the system of record for financial and operational data. This prevents data duplication and ensures that each system is responsible for maintaining the integrity of its respective data.
Data synchronization between systems must be automated to minimize manual intervention and reduce the risk of errors. This can be achieved through scheduled data transfers, real-time API calls, or event-driven workflows. For example, when a student's enrollment status changes in the SIS, an API call can trigger an update in the ERP system, ensuring that billing and financial aid records are updated immediately. This real-time synchronization is critical for maintaining accurate operational reporting and preventing discrepancies. Additionally, data validation and reconciliation processes must be implemented to ensure that data transferred between systems is accurate and complete. This includes checking for missing records, duplicate entries, and data format inconsistencies.
Workflow Architecture and Automation Opportunities
Workflow architecture is the backbone of operational efficiency in education institutions. It defines how tasks move between people, systems, and automation layers. In an Odoo-based ERP, workflows can be configured to automate routine tasks, such as invoice generation, payment reconciliation, and report generation. This reduces manual effort and frees up staff to focus on higher-value activities. For example, the Invoicing module can be configured to automatically generate tuition invoices based on enrollment data from the SIS, reducing the need for manual data entry. Similarly, the Accounting module can be configured to automatically reconcile payments with invoices, ensuring that financial records are accurate and up-to-date.
Automation opportunities extend beyond financial processes to include academic and administrative workflows. For example, the Project module can be used to automate course scheduling, ensuring that faculty availability, classroom capacity, and student demand are considered. The Human Resources module can be used to automate faculty hiring processes, including job postings, candidate screening, and onboarding. These automation opportunities not only improve efficiency but also enhance consistency and compliance. By standardizing workflows and automating routine tasks, institutions can reduce errors, improve data accuracy, and ensure that processes are executed consistently across departments and campuses.
Reporting and Governance Frameworks
Operational reporting is a critical function of the ERP system, providing executives with the insights needed to make informed decisions. In an education institution, reporting must cover a wide range of areas, including financial performance, academic outcomes, resource utilization, and compliance. The ERP system must be capable of generating these reports in a timely and accurate manner, with the ability to drill down into specific details as needed. For example, financial reports should provide a detailed view of revenue, expenses, and cash flow, with the ability to segment data by department, campus, or academic program. Academic reports should provide insights into student enrollment, retention, and graduation rates, with the ability to track trends over time.
Governance frameworks are essential for ensuring that reporting is accurate, consistent, and compliant with regulatory requirements. This includes defining data ownership, access controls, and audit trails. Data ownership must be clearly defined, with each department responsible for maintaining the integrity of its respective data. Access controls must be implemented to ensure that only authorized users can access sensitive data, such as student financial information or faculty performance data. Audit trails must be maintained to track all changes to data, ensuring that any discrepancies can be investigated and resolved. These governance frameworks not only improve data accuracy but also enhance transparency and accountability, which are critical for maintaining trust with stakeholders.
Security, Privacy, and Compliance Considerations
Security and privacy are paramount in education institutions, where sensitive student and faculty data is stored and processed. The ERP system must be configured to meet the institution's security requirements, including data encryption, access controls, and audit logging. Data encryption should be implemented for data at rest and in transit, ensuring that sensitive information is protected from unauthorized access. Access controls should be based on role-based permissions, ensuring that users only have access to the data they need to perform their jobs. Audit logging should be enabled to track all user activities, providing a trail of evidence in case of security incidents or compliance audits.
Compliance with data privacy laws, such as FERPA in the United States or GDPR in Europe, is also a critical consideration. The ERP system must be configured to support these regulatory requirements, including data retention policies, consent management, and data subject rights. For example, the system must be capable of deleting or anonymizing student data upon request, in accordance with data privacy laws. Additionally, the system must be capable of generating compliance reports, demonstrating that the institution is meeting its regulatory obligations. By prioritizing security, privacy, and compliance, institutions can protect sensitive data and maintain trust with students, faculty, and regulators.
Implementation Strategy and Change Management
Implementing an ERP system in an education institution is a complex process that requires careful planning, execution, and change management. The implementation strategy should be phased, starting with core financial and administrative processes, and gradually expanding to include academic and operational workflows. This phased approach allows the institution to manage risk, ensure data accuracy, and train users effectively. The first phase should focus on configuring the Accounting, Invoicing, and Human Resources modules, ensuring that financial and HR processes are aligned and automated. The second phase should focus on integrating with the SIS and LMS, ensuring that academic data is synchronized with the ERP system. The third phase should focus on implementing advanced workflows and reporting capabilities, ensuring that the institution has full visibility into its operations.
Change management is a critical component of the implementation strategy, ensuring that users are prepared for the new system and are willing to adopt it. This includes training, communication, and support. Training should be tailored to different user roles, ensuring that each user understands how the new system affects their daily tasks. Communication should be ongoing, keeping users informed about the implementation progress, benefits, and any changes to their workflows. Support should be available during and after the implementation, ensuring that users can resolve issues quickly and efficiently. By prioritizing change management, institutions can ensure a smooth transition to the new system and maximize the benefits of the ERP implementation.
Risk Management and Trade-Offs
ERP implementation in education institutions carries inherent risks, including data migration errors, workflow disruptions, and user resistance. These risks must be identified and managed proactively to ensure a successful implementation. Data migration errors can occur if data is not validated and reconciled before being transferred to the new system. This can lead to inaccurate financial records, incorrect billing, and compliance issues. To mitigate this risk, data migration should be tested thoroughly, with multiple rounds of validation and reconciliation. Workflow disruptions can occur if new workflows are not aligned with existing processes, leading to confusion and inefficiency. To mitigate this risk, workflows should be mapped and tested before being implemented, ensuring that they are aligned with existing processes and user expectations.
User resistance is another significant risk, as users may be reluctant to adopt new systems and processes. This can be mitigated through effective change management, including training, communication, and support. Additionally, trade-offs must be considered when configuring the ERP system. For example, automating a workflow may improve efficiency but reduce flexibility, making it difficult to handle exceptional cases. To mitigate this trade-off, workflows should be designed with flexibility in mind, allowing for manual overrides when necessary. By managing risks and trade-offs proactively, institutions can ensure a successful ERP implementation that delivers the desired benefits.
